- Be able to lift 50 pounds as well as sit, stand, and walk for up to 10 hours at a time with or without reasonable accommodation
- Previous forklift experience preferred (Must pass forklift certification process - both written and driving tests)
- Willing to work on industrial powered equipment
- Reliable punctual team player
- Uses RF scanner to pick orders and relocate products using forklifts and other equipment
- Handles all inbound/outbound warehouse products (pick, unload, label, store).
- Maintains a clean and safe work area throughout the distribution center
- Handles high volume workload while maintaining a high level of accuracy to ensure inventory accuracy
